Pak-UAE bilateral relations moving on right direction: Analysts
January 11, 2023

Waheed Ahmed (Former Ambassador): The fact is that Pak-UAE relations are multidimensional including leadership to leadership, people to people and institutional level relations. Unfortunately, both the countries have not been able to apply full potential of trade between them. It is pertinent to mention here that the leadership of the UAE was also engaged with Pakistan prior to the Geneva conference. During the visit to United Arab Emirates, the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if will look for the enhancement of trade and economic relations between the two countries. The United Arab Emirates can also support Pakistan in mitigating the impacts of the import bill. It is a good opportunity for both countries to review their relations according to their potential. The defense cooperation between the two countries also needs to be enhanced. Pakistan can provide training and other technical support to the UAE. The construction boom in UAE will need expert manpower and Pakistan can provide support to UAE in this regard.

Dr. Amna Mehmood (IR Expert): Pakistan is passing through a difficult time as currently, we have been facing severe economic challenges. At the Geneva Conference, Pakistan managed to pledge a sufficient amount for the rehabilitation of floods victims in the country from the international donors. Now, the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if is going to visit the United Arab Emirates as the UAE always supported Pakistan in difficult times. The Emirate Bank and Dubai Bank have already rolled over the amount of 1.2 billion dollars. Pakistan's due debts are being returned on time and the country’s forex reserves will stabilize again very soon.
